What is the primary characteristic of Expressionism?

  1. Emphasis on emotional expression

  2. Use of realistic and objective forms

  3. Adherence to traditional artistic techniques

  4. Depiction of everyday life and mundane objects


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Expressionism is characterized by its focus on expressing the artist's inner emotions and subjective experiences, rather than depicting objective reality.

What is the significance of color in Expressionism?

  1. It is used to convey emotions and psychological states.

  2. It is used to create a sense of realism and depth.

  3. It is used to depict natural light and atmospheric conditions.

  4. It is used to create a sense of harmony and balance.


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

In Expressionism, color is used as a powerful tool to express the artist's emotions and psychological states, rather than to depict objective reality.

What is the significance of distortion and exaggeration in Expressionism?

  1. It is used to create a sense of realism and depth.

  2. It is used to convey emotions and psychological states.

  3. It is used to depict natural light and atmospheric conditions.

  4. It is used to create a sense of harmony and balance.


Correct Option: B
Explanation:

In Expressionism, distortion and exaggeration are used to convey the artist's emotions and psychological states, rather than to depict objective reality.
